January Weather in Lincoln, United States

Last updated: June 24, 2025

In January, the average temperature in Lincoln, United States hovers around 0°C (33°F). While you're likely to experience a minimum dip to -20°C (-5°F), temperatures can rise as high as 20°C (67°F). Expect about 64 mm (2.5 in) of precipitation over 6 days, and prepare for a rather humid atmosphere with an average humidity of 80%.

U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.

How January Weather in Lincoln Compares to Other Months

Weather in Lincoln var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ares January’s weather to other months in Lincoln,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in Lincoln, showing how January’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ather0°C (33°F)64 mm (2.5 inches)80%moderate
February Weather2°C (35°F)60 mm (2.4 inches)78%moderate
March Weather9°C (48°F)119 mm (4.7 inches)75%high
April Weather13°C (55°F)118 mm (4.6 inches)77%very high
May Weather19°C (67°F)187 mm (7.4 inches)82%very high
June Weather25°C (77°F)110 mm (4.3 inches)83%extreme
July Weather27°C (80°F)122 mm (4.8 inches)81%extreme
August Weather25°C (77°F)104 mm (4.1 inches)78%very high
September Weather22°C (73°F)63 mm (2.5 inches)72%very high
October Weather15°C (58°F)101 mm (4.0 inches)72%high
November Weather7°C (45°F)54 mm (2.1 inches)84%moderate
December Weather4°C (40°F)38 mm (1.5 inches)86%moderate
